Colonia, Uruguay: A Historical Gem

Day Trips from Buenos Aires to Uruguay are always a great idea. A short ferry ride from Buenos Aires via Colonia Express, Colonia del Sacramento in Uruguay is a captivating destination. Rec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, Colonia exudes a charm reminiscent of a bygone era with its cobbled streets and well-preserved colonial architecture. This historic city, founded in the 17th century, serves as an ideal day trip from Buenos Aires, offering a serene escape from the hustle and bustle of the Argentine capital.

Upon arrival, immerse yourself in the town's rich history by exploring its historic district, Barrio Histórico, on foot. Wander through the narrow lanes with colorful houses, quaint cafes, and small museums. Don't miss landmarks like the iconic lighthouse, the Portón de Campo (the city gate), and the Basílica del Santísimo Sacramento. The town’s laid-back atmosphere and picturesque settings make it a photographer's paradise and a haven for history buffs.

 

Iguazu Falls: Nature's Majesty

For those seeking a blend of adventure and natural beauty, a journey from Buenos Aires to Iguazu Falls is an unforgettable experience. Flying from Buenos Aires to Iguazu, this natural wonder is located on the border between Argentina and Brazil. The falls, one of the New Seven Wonders of Nature, are breathtaking with their immense scale and raw power.

To fully appreciate the grandeur of Iguazu Falls, consider staying overnight in the area. This allows you to experience the falls at various times, from the misty mornings to the golden hues of sunset. Various walking trails and viewing platforms provide different perspectives of the falls. The Devil's Throat, a U-shaped cliff, is a must-see for its awe-inspiring views.

For an even more immersive experience, boat tours take you up close to the cascading waters. Also, the surrounding Iguazu National Park, a biodiversity hotspot, offers additional activities like bird watching, wildlife tours, and educational walks through the subtropical rainforest. Staying overnight in the area also allows you to explore the local culture and cuisine, adding another layer to your Iguazu Falls adventure.

 

 

San Antonio de Areco: Gaucho Culture Experience

San Antonio de Areco, a town in the Argentine pampas, is a vibrant testament to the country's gaucho culture. This destination transports visitors back in time, immersing them in Argentina's rich rural and cowboy heritage. The town is celebrated for its traditional silversmiths (plateros), rustic estancias (ranches), and lively folkloric events, offering a deeply authentic cultural experience.

As you stroll through San Antonio de Areco, you’ll find historic buildings and museums such as the Museo Gauchesco Ricardo Güiraldes, which shed light on the gaucho way of life. Artisan shops in the town exhibit fine leather and silver craftsmanship, characteristic of gaucho artistry.

Traveling to San Antonio de Areco from Buenos Aires is quite convenient. Several transport options are available, including flights offered by Aerolineas Argentina to nearby cities and a short journey to the town. For those who prefer road travel, the bus terminal in Buenos Aires provides regular services to San Antonio de Areco.

This journey by bus allows travelers to enjoy the scenic beauty of the Argentine countryside while transitioning from the urban landscape of Buenos Aires to the tranquil rural setting of the pampas. Visiting an estancia is a highlight of the trip, offering a glimpse into the daily life of gauchos with activities like horseback riding and the chance to savor a traditional asado (barbecue).

 

Mar del Plata: Seaside Escape

Mar del Plata, situated on Argentina's Atlantic coast, is a favorite seaside destination for locals and tourists. Known for its beautiful beaches, lively cultural scene, and excellent seafood, it's the perfect spot for a weekend getaway from Buenos Aires.

The city boasts a range of beaches, from the bustling Playa Grande to the more tranquil Playa Varese. You'll find a vibrant boardwalk along the coast with cafes, restaurants, and nightclubs. The city's architecture, a mix of modern and Belle Époque, adds to its charm.

Seafood is a highlight in Mar del Plata; you'll find restaurants serving fresh and delicious dishes. Local specialties include rabas (fried squid rings), paella marinera, and various fish dishes. Be sure to try a traditional alfajor marplatense, a sweet treat famous in the region.

 

 

Tigre: A Riverfront Adventure

Tigre, located just north of Buenos Aires, offers a distinctive riverfront adventure set against the picturesque backdrop of the Paraná Delta. This town is a gateway to the vast network of rivers and islands and a tranquil retreat from the city's hustle and bustle. Its unique geography, with numerous streams and green islands, makes it a popular destination for locals and tourists seeking a serene yet adventurous experience.

One of the highlights in Tigre is the boat rides along the delta. These boat trips offer a unique way to explore the area's natural beauty. You can rent a private boat for a more personal experience or join a guided river cruise, which provides insights into the local ecosystem and culture. As you navigate the channels, you'll see various flora and fauna, quaint riverside homes, and floating services like supermarkets and restaurants.

Another must-visit is the Museo de Arte Tigre (Tigre Art Museum), housed in an opulent Belle Époque building. The museum showcases a collection of Argentine art, focusing on works depicting life along the delta. The town of Tigre itself is charming, with a relaxed atmosphere, riverside restaurants, craft markets, and quaint antique shops. The Puerto de Frutos, a bustling market, is a great place to browse for local handicrafts, furniture, and regional foods.
